It All Began with a Leap of Faith
In 1998, Hannes Van Jaarsveld, a former audit firm partner, found himself at a crossroads. Frustrated with financial constraints faced by farmers, he stepped away from auditing and into a new challenge—joining Roller Mills as Financial Director. But when poor financial decisions sent the company spiralling toward collapse, Hannes took a bold step, securing Montego Feeds.
But Montego Feeds was already struggling. When Business Partners offered him the chance to take over the company, he had no cash reserves and was bound by a three-year clause preventing him from returning to auditing. Yet, Hannes leaned on his faith:
"All I had was my faith in the Lord that He would be by my side."
Determined to turn Montego around, Hannes reformulated its recipes, ensuring the food was both high-quality and affordable—two loyal customers prepaid in cash, allowing him to buy raw materials and fulfil his first orders. With just 11 employees, he built the business from the ground up, driven by hard work and a vision of the brand's future potential.
Today his dream has grown to include over 800 permanent staff and a team of Hannes and his three sons: Morné, Johan and Marco. Underpinning his success was always faith in God. Morné Van Jaarsveld: A Hands-On Start & The Drive for Global Expansion
In 2003, Hannes knew he couldn’t build Montego alone. He needed dedicated, trusted hands, and his son Morné was the first to step in. For him, it was about rolling up his sleeves and building something great alongside his family.
With a background in Town and Regional Planning, Morné’s career seemed far from pet nutrition, yet he quickly found his place—handling HR, payroll, and finance while taking on sales, literally door-to-door. His plan of action was to “calculate the type and number of dogs of all the customers, calculate when they should buy a new bag and then he phoned them a day or two in advance to find out if I could deliver another bag,” This is how he brought his passion for the brand to bear; filled with drive and enthusiasm.
Armed with a VW Polo, Morné delivered Montego products himself, making multiple trips each night to fulfil orders. He loved those early days when decisions were made quickly, and everyone knew everyone. “Throughout my time at Montego, I also kept myself informed of all of the processes.” Regularly assisting where he could he became more and more involved in the administration of the business and stepped into the role of Administrative Manager in 2005.
Today, as Corporate Service Director, his focus has shifted outward—towards international expansion, particularly in the USA. While maintaining Montego’s family-driven culture he believes an entrepreneurial spirit is also the heartbeat of the company.
His dream? Sustainability. He envisions Montego not just as a business, but as a lasting force, supporting employees, families, and communities through continued growth. Johan Van Jaarsveld: Building the Montego Brand & Strengthening Retail Loyalty
Johan officially joined in 2004, but he had already left his mark as a student, designing Montego’s first website. His background in Tourism and Recreation Management might have led him elsewhere, but instead, Like his brother Morné, Johan also put in the groundwork in the company’s early years.
Before taking on a leadership role, he spent time delivering samples to customers’ homes, building relationships with retailers, and helping to grow the brand from the ground up. He jumped into Montego’s sales and marketing, helping establish Montego’s brand presence across Southern Africa and beyond.
One of his toughest moments came during Montego’s first major factory upgrade, when demand far outpaced supply. Where others may have faltered Johan picked up the phone and personally called over 200 retailers, telling them deliveries were delayed by 25 weeks. But instead of frustration, he found loyalty—Montego’s customers believed in the brand and stood by them. A remarkable achievement in the face of potential disaster.
Today, as Managing Director, Johan’s vision is global expansion, ensuring Montego’s success outlasts his own lifetime. Through strong marketing, branding, and corporate responsibility and balancing growth with integrity, Johan has ensured that Montego remains a brand that customers can trust and employees can be proud of.
Some of his impact can be seen in Montego’s marketing milestones, including:
✅ First billboard in 2006 marking a new era of brand visibility.
✅ First TV commercial in 2012 reaching a nationwide audience.
✅ The Montego rebrand with a new logo modernising its image in 2019
✅ The launch of M Magazine in 2020, making Montego a thought leader in pet nutrition
✅ The stellar introduction of Cosmic Kitty Evolution treats in 2024.

Marco Van Jaarsveld: Innovating Montego’s Future, One Production Line at a Time
Marco’s path to Montego was unlike his brothers'. A pilot by trade, he spent years flying commercial planes and working with humanitarian organisations like the World Food Programme and Red Cross. Yet, during his month-long breaks, he worked at Montego, where he learnt everything from offloading raw materials to lab analysis.
By 2005, he took the plunge and joined full-time as Production Manager, overseeing Montego’s evolution from manual labour to a high-tech operation. Today, as Technical Director, he leads state-of-the-art factory upgrades, including:
- 2015: Earned FSSC 22000 Food Safety Accreditation, proving their commitment to quality.
- A R70 million expansion in 2019
- A R22 million investment in solar power to combat load shedding
- New production facilities in Rosslyn (2021) and Centurion (2022) with an expanded fleet of trucks
- By 2022 Montego owned depots in all nine provinces further enhancing distribution
